FANUC's A16B-1110-0020 printed circuit board is essential for controlling functions in CNC systems. It is crafted for compatibility with the Series 16i, 18i, and 21i, making it adaptable for different setups. This PCB acts as the main control unit and utilizes a 2K ROM memory type for storing necessary instructions.

The mounting is designed as a flange mount, providing secure installation. The shaft type is tapered, compatible with an incremental encoder. Weighing in at 2.27 kg, this PCB is manageable while still robust enough for industrial use. It operates seamlessly within a temperature range of 0 to 40 degrees Celsius, making it suitable for many working environments. In terms of humidity, it can endure operating conditions of up to 80% without condensation. Additionally, it is rated for use at altitudes of 1000 meters above sea level, ensuring reliability in various elevation scenarios.
